Manual Schedule
Your computer's performance is maximized if you
schedule your critical operations to occur when your
computer is idle. When you schedule backup weekly
or monthly and check Run only at idle time, Norton
360 backs up your files when your computer is idle.
Symantec recommends that you check Run only at idle
time to experience better performance of your
computer.
Specifying Idle Time Out duration
You can set the duration after which Norton 360 should
identify your computer as idle. You can select a value
(in minutes) between 1 minute and 30 minutes. When
you do not use your computer for the specified
duration, Norton 360 identifies your computer as idle.
Norton 360 then runs the activities that are scheduled
to run at idle time.
To specify Idle Time Out duration from the Settings
window
1
In the Norton 360 main window, click Settings.
2
In the Settings window, under Detailed Settings,
click Administrative Settings.
3
In the Idle Time Out row, in the drop-down list,
select the duration that you want to specify.
You might need to scroll the window to view the
option.
4
In the Settings window, click Apply.
